Python selenium firefoxダウンロードファイルディレクトリ

Seleniumを使う際のfirefoxプロファイルを設定する手順を メモしておく。 環境とバージョン Ubuntu(デスクトップ)は14.04 Firefoxは31.0 Selenium Serverは2.42.1 firefoxプロファイルの作成 コマンドラインを開いて、下記コマンドを実行する。

セレンのfirefox webdriverでファイルをダウンロードしようとしています。 .dmgファイル以外のすべてのファイル形式をダウンロードするときに、ファイルを保存するためのポップアップが表示されないようにfirefoxを設定することができました。 2011年7月9日 SeleniumHQ サイトのダウンロードページから、「Selenium Client Drivers」のうち「Launguage」が「Java」のものをダウンロードする。 利用時には、selenium-java-2.0.0.jar および libs/ フォルダ内の全 jar ファイルをクラスパスに追加する。 Java 版はクライアントのみでも HtmlUnit、Firefox、Internet Explorer、Opera のテストができるが、 C#、Ruby、Python を使う場合にはあらかじめ起動済みのサーバに接続 

2016/10/24

Selenium Firefox Driver. ここから最新版をダウンロードする。 本記事執筆時点だとv0.20.1の「 geckodriver-v0.20.1-macos.tar.gz」をダウンロード。 ダウンロードしたらファイルを解凍する。 2 Python Seleniumを使用して完全なWebページをダウンロードする方法 人気のある質問 147 のJava 8メソッド参照:Iコンストラクタパラメータを要求する例外の種類と

java.util.Optional.orElseThrow() 

を使用したいパラメータ化された結果 Python + Selenium + Firefoxでファイルダウンロード はじめに 最近仕事でPythonを使ったwebスクレイピングをします。 seleniumとfirefoxを使っていますが、色々と貼ったので備忘録として残します。 python - Selenium ChromeはPDFのダウンロードフォルダを保存します; browsermob proxy - HARで応答本文を取得できない、PythonでBrowsermobproxy + selenium + FireFox; PythonとSelenium WebDriverでlocalStorageを取得する方法; python seleniumログインセッションエラー:TimeoutException:メッセージ Javaを使用したSelenium-ドライバーの実行可能ファイルへのパスは、webdriver.gecko.driverシステムプロパティで設定する必要があります (3) Mozillaを起動しようとしていますが、それでもこのエラーが発生します。 Sep 26, 2016 · Pythonに元々入っている「webbrowser」モジュールの使い勝手微妙だったので、seleniumを使って操作してみる. “PythonでChromeを操作する” is published by Selenium + Python によるアップロードアプリの動作確認プログラム作成 投稿日:2019年8月19日 更新日: 2019年10月8日 私の周りでは、なぜか Selenium が流行っている模様です。

Sep 26, 2016 · Pythonに元々入っている「webbrowser」モジュールの使い勝手微妙だったので、seleniumを使って操作してみる. “PythonでChromeを操作する” is published by

ダウンロードが完了するのを待つためのSeleniumには組み込みの方法はありません。ここでの一般的な考え方は、「ダウンロード」ディレクトリにファイルが表示されるまで待機することです。 これは、ファイルの存在を何度も繰り返しチェックすることで実現できます。 2020/01/30 2020/04/10 最近、この問題に出会いました。私は一度に複数のファイルをダウンロードしており、ダウンロードが失敗した場合にタイムアウトするようにビルドする必要がありました。 このコードは、ダウンロードディレクトリ内のファイル名を1秒ごとにチェックし、ファイルが完了するか終了するまで 2018/11/05

$ apt-get install firefox Firefoxのレンダリングエンジンであるgeckoをseleniumから利用するためのドライバーが別途必要。 こちらからダウンロードできるので、OSの種類に応じてダウンロードする。 今回は64ビット版のLinuxなので以下のように。

2016/03/28 セレンのfirefox webdriverでファイルをダウンロードしようとしています。 .dmgファイル以外のすべてのファイル形式をダウンロードするときに、ファイルを保存するためのポップアップが表示されないようにfirefoxを設定することができました。 @saurabhの答えはこの問題を解決しますが、 Pythonで退屈なものを自動化する ことがこれらのステップを含まない理由を説明していません。 これは、本がselenium 2.xに基づいているために発生し、そのシリーズのFirefoxドライバーはgeckoドライバーを必要としません。 前回、Pythonでグーグルのブラウザ「Chrome」を操作する方法を記しました。 他にもPythonにはFireFoxを操作する事も可能です。 geckodriverのインストール方法 FireFoxをseleniumで操作するにはgeckodriverという物をインストールする必要が 2019/10/25 2019/10/16

2019/11/21 2020/03/27 前提・実現したいこと python selenium でダウンロードしてきたファイルをデスクトップに保存したいです。 やり方は↓サイトで載っている通りにしたのですが、デフォルトダウンロードの「Downloads」フォルダに落ちてきてしまいます。 2020/04/25 私はPythonとセレンに取り組んでいます。 セレンを使ってイベントをクリックしてファイルをダウンロードしたい 私は次のコードを書いた。 from selenium import webdriver from selenium.common.exceptions import NoSuchElementException from ダウンロードが完了するのを待つためのSeleniumには組み込みの方法はありません。ここでの一般的な考え方は、「ダウンロード」ディレクトリにファイルが表示されるまで待機することです。 これは、ファイルの存在を何度も繰り返しチェックすることで実現できます。 2020/01/30

2019年4月16日 数年前まではRubyやPython、Node.jsなどを使用するか、もしくはPHPのGoutteを使用する場合が多かったブラウザの自動操作ですが、. Facebookの作ったライブラリ「facebook/php-webdriver」を使用すると、PHPでも簡単にブラウザの自動操作が行えます。 そんな便利な ヘッドレスモードではファイルダウンロードが行えない; ChromeDriver::start()ではタイムアウト値が固定されている. という問題点がある ダウンロードディレクトリを設定(ヘッドレスモードでダウンロード処理が行えない対策). 2020年1月22日 なお、本記事ではChromeを扱っていますが、Firefoxでもヘッドレスモードは提供されています。 感謝しつつ、今回はこちらののリリースからchromiumバイナリをダウンロードして使用します。 Chromeの実行バイナリ、ChromeDriver、Selenium、それぞれの準備を済ませ、次のようなディレクトリ構成ができました。 今回、 sls create -t aws-python -p {プロジェクト名} でテンプレートを作成した都合上、Pythonバージョンは”3.6″の指定 Layerの際と同じく、ymlファイルにデプロイ内容を記述します。 2019年1月26日 ダウンロードしたファイルはzipフォルダなので展開します。展開すると中に「chromedriver」というexeファイルが入っていますのでこのexeファイルを好きなフォルダに入れます。 今回は分かり  2016年6月3日 Java, C#, Python, Ruby, Perl, PHPがサポートされていますが、ここではRubyを用いた例を示すことにします。 ブラウザ本体とは別に、IEDriverServerという、SeleniumとブラウザをつなぐソフトをダウンロードしてPATHを通しておく必要が して確認および変更ができる、Firefoxの挙動の設定群) を設定して指定のディレクトリに確認なしで保存するようにします。 profile = Selenium::WebDriver::Firefox::Profile.new # ファイルをダウンロードする既定のフォルダ # - 0: デスクトップ # - 1: システム既定の  2019年2月23日 Seleniumでブラウザを操作するにはWebDriverと呼ばれる実行ファイルを事前にダウンロードしておく必要があります。 Chromeの場合はChromeDriver – WebDriver for Chromeからダウンロードできます。 Downloads -  5 日前 ほかにも例えば、あるWebサイトから、10記事分くらいデータを収集して、画像を全てダウンロードしたいとします。 Pythonを利用したWebスクレイピングを行えば、指定した文字、ファイルなどを、プログラムで自動収集することができるようになります。 Requestsだと認証で躓くが、Seleniumだとブラウザ操作でログイン情報を入力したりできるので、ログインが必要なサイトからのデータ取得が簡単; Requestsだと、 

2019年4月8日 この時、ロボットで開いた上記のブラウザをクローズし、改めてロボットを起動すると、ダウンロード先を変更した設定がクリアされ、いつものダウンロードフォルダを保存先としていました。 これは、ブラウザを開く>ダウンロード先変更>ブラウザを 

2019年12月10日 Seleniumを使う場合はググるとSelenium+Pythonばかり出てきますが、Selenium VBAで検索するとSelenium Basicというもの 下記URL Download Relase pageリンクからexeをダウンロードしインストールします。 ちなみに最後のFirefox Addonインストールは壊れていて追加できないと言われます。 Examples\AutoIt\ListLinksToExcel.au3 ファイルがあります。 インストールされたディレクトリにはchromedriver.exe、edgedriver.exeなどが入っていますが、当然古いのでお使いのブラウザに  2011年7月9日 SeleniumHQ サイトのダウンロードページから、「Selenium Client Drivers」のうち「Launguage」が「Java」のものをダウンロードする。 利用時には、selenium-java-2.0.0.jar および libs/ フォルダ内の全 jar ファイルをクラスパスに追加する。 Java 版はクライアントのみでも HtmlUnit、Firefox、Internet Explorer、Opera のテストができるが、 C#、Ruby、Python を使う場合にはあらかじめ起動済みのサーバに接続  2018年4月21日 seleniumでヘッドレスChromeブラウザを立ち上げながら自動操作をしていく流れの中で. Chrome拡張機能を噛 という場合は、拡張機能の元ファイルである"crx"ファイルをダウンロードして実行ディレクトリにファイルごと保管してしまいましょう! 色々と調べるとpythonの標準ライブラリにGUI操作のパッケージがありました! 2010年4月4日 Firefox アドオンとして動作する Selenium IDE のほか、Selenium Remote Control、Selenium Grid、Selenium on SeleniumHQ の ダウンロードページ から Selenium-RC をダウンロードします。 Python で Selenium テストを記述するか、またはスクリプトを Selenium-IDE から Python ファイルにエクスポートします。 2019年4月16日 数年前まではRubyやPython、Node.jsなどを使用するか、もしくはPHPのGoutteを使用する場合が多かったブラウザの自動操作ですが、. Facebookの作ったライブラリ「facebook/php-webdriver」を使用すると、PHPでも簡単にブラウザの自動操作が行えます。 そんな便利な ヘッドレスモードではファイルダウンロードが行えない; ChromeDriver::start()ではタイムアウト値が固定されている. という問題点がある ダウンロードディレクトリを設定(ヘッドレスモードでダウンロード処理が行えない対策).